钢渣深处理技术
引用本文:瞿仁静.钢渣深处理技术[J].云南环境科学,2010,29(5):63-65,81.
作者姓名:瞿仁静
作者单位:昆明冶金研究院,云南,昆明,650031 
摘    要:以昆钢本部及红钢所产的转炉钢渣作为研究对象,研究热泼钢渣的矿物组成,分析钢渣中有价金属的组成,确定不同的粒级、不同的磁场强度,采用干式磁选与湿式磁选相结合的“一段闭路破碎,磁滑轮磁选;一段开路磨矿,一粗一精选别”深度处理流程,应用于红钢钢渣磁选车间及昆钢钢渣磁选厂,获得良好的磁选指标。分析了项目实施过程中渣浆输送断流的原因,找出解决办法。总结了项目产生的效益。

Advanced Treatment Technique of Steel Slag
Institution:Ren-jing (Kunming Metallurgy Research Institute, Kunming Yunnan 650031 China)
Abstract:The steel slag produced from converter of Kungang is the target. The mineral components of the poured hot mineral slag are researched as well as the composition of the metals and the different fractions of different magnetic. The process of dry magnetic separation and wet magnetic separation combination of closed-circuit crushing and magnetic pulley separator and open-grinding and a rough of a selection of other is applied in magnetic separation plant in Honghe steel slag and Kungang magnetic plant. The reasons of slurry transport interruption are analyzed and found out in the end.
